Subject: Bloomgate cut-over complete

Welcome, new folks. Last night we finished moving Pellwick's key-value store behind the Bloomgate filter layer. Reads now check the bloom filter first, cutting misses to the backing store by roughly 80%. False-positive rate is tuned conservatively. Please review carefully before touching anything. The current service configuration is as follows.

service settings:
[eliix]
port = 7000
region = central-4
host = eliix.crelvocorp.local
team = fraael
timeout_ms = 3000
retries = 4

# BranchSweep Bot — Env Vars

Quick reference for the release manager. BranchSweep prunes branches with no commits in `SWEEP_STALE_DAYS` (default 45). Set `SWEEP_DRY_RUN=true` before any release freeze so nobody's hotfix branch vanishes mid-cycle — yes, that happened once, no, we don't talk about it. `SWEEP_PROTECTED_GLOBS` keeps release branches safe. The bot needs write access to the repo host, which it gets via a token scoped to branch deletion only. That token lives on the next line of the env file.

vault entry, yahif-yajep: COURIER_KEY29=b802bdf8034096b65a51c6ba5abe2

## Formula sandbox tuning

User-supplied formulas in Gridmoor execute inside a restricted interpreter with hard ceilings on time, memory, and call depth. Reviewers should confirm any change to these ceilings is justified in the PR description, since raising them widens the abuse surface. Defaults were chosen from production traces. The current limits are as follows.

limits module of tafog-fawip:
WEIGHTS = {
    "julix": 57,
    "lamys": 992,
    "kasvan": 209,
    "quenok": 750,
    "alddor": 259,
    "oliath": 1009,
    "wenix": 815,
}

Runbook fragment — QueuePoint kiosk watchdog. The watchdog restarts the kiosk shell if the heartbeat file is not touched for 90 seconds. Three restarts within ten minutes put the kiosk into maintenance mode with a grey screen. To recover: confirm the peripheral hub is powered, clear the heartbeat stall counter from the admin panel, then reboot once. If maintenance mode returns, capture the watchdog log before escalating. Quote the current build when filing, using the token below.

pipeline stamp: htk31_f769b577b3028a4e9958e5bb8d1259a